Realistic travel data usage
| Activity | Typical data use | Best advice |
|---|---|---|
| Maps + messaging | 150MB - 300MB/day | Good fit for a starter eSIM. |
| Email + browsing | 100MB - 250MB/day | Use normally, but avoid big downloads. |
| Social media | 300MB - 700MB/day | Upload videos on Wi-Fi when possible. |
| Video calls | 500MB - 1.5GB/hour | Use Wi-Fi for long calls. |
| Streaming video | 1GB+/hour | Not recommended on a small free plan. |

Install your free Czech Republic eSIM in minutes
- Request your free Czech Republic eSIM before your trip.
- Open the QR code or installation link on a second screen.
- Go to your phone mobile data settings and add a new eSIM.
- Install the profile, but keep it switched off until you are ready to use it.
- After arriving in Czech Republic, enable the eSIM for mobile data and turn data roaming on for that eSIM line only if required.
Roaming, Wi-Fi or eSIM in Czech Republic?
| Option | Pros | Cons | Best for |
|---|---|---|---|
| Free Czech Republic eSIM | Fast setup, no SIM swap, good for arrival | Starter data is not for heavy streaming | Maps, messages, hotels, rides, tickets |
| Carrier roaming | Works through your existing carrier | Can be expensive or unclear | Emergency backup or very short trips |
| Airport SIM | May include local calls | Queues, physical SIM swap, possible ID checks | Long stays where a local number is needed |
| Public Wi-Fi | Free in many hotels and cafés | Not always available; privacy risk | Large downloads and streaming |

Phone compatibility before using a Czech Republic eSIM
Before requesting your eSIM, confirm that your device is unlocked and supports eSIM. Compatibility depends on your exact phone model, carrier lock status, and regional version.
- Your phone must be carrier-unlocked.
- Your phone must support eSIM installation.
- Most iPhone XR / XS and newer models support eSIM.
- Many Samsung Galaxy S20 and newer flagship models support eSIM.
- Some regional phone versions do not include eSIM, so check settings before departure.

Can I install my Czech Republic eSIM before I fly?
Yes. Install it before departure, then activate mobile data when you arrive in Czech Republic.
Will I get a local phone number in Czech Republic?
Most travel eSIMs are data-only, so they usually do not include a local phone number.
Is mobile data safer than public Wi-Fi in Czech Republic?
Mobile data is often safer than unknown public Wi-Fi for banking, work accounts, and private messages.
Can I delete the eSIM after visiting Czech Republic?
Yes. You can remove the eSIM profile from your phone settings after your trip.
Can I use WhatsApp with a Czech Republic eSIM?
Yes. WhatsApp can keep your existing number while your Czech Republic eSIM provides mobile data.
Should I turn data roaming on for the Czech Republic eSIM?
Many travel eSIMs require data roaming on the eSIM line. Keep roaming off on your main SIM if you want to avoid carrier roaming fees.
